Auburn man suffers severe hand injury, burns to face in fireworks accident
AUBURN, Wash. -- A man in his 30s suffered a severe hand injury and burns to his face Wednesday night after lighting a mortar round in his hand, the Auburn Police Department said.
The man was rushed to Seattle's Harborview Medical Center.
Auburn police said they responded at about 7:30 p.m. to the fireworks injury in the 3700 block of I Street Northeast, along the river bike trail.
No other information was immediately released.
